制备了阳极负载型LDC-LSGM双层电解质薄膜电池.考察了单电池在分别使用甲醇和氢气两种燃料时,不同温度下的I~V性能.以甲醇为燃料,以空气为氧化剂时,800℃下的最大输出功率密度为1.07W/cm2,而使用氢气为燃料时,最大输出功率密度为1.54W/cm2.通过交流阻抗研究了造成甲醇性能降低的可能原因.结果表明,以甲醇作为燃料时,单电池性能较氢气作为燃料时低.  相似文献

Remarkable power density was obtained for anode-supported solid oxide fuel cells (SOFCs) based on La0.8Sr0.2Ga0.8Mg0.2O3−δ (LSGM) electrolyte films, fabricated following an original procedure that allowed avoiding undesired reactions between LSGM and electrode materials, especially Ni. Electrophoretic deposition (EPD) was used for the fabrication of 30 μm-thick electrolyte films. Anode supports were made of La0.4Ce0.6O2−x (LDC). The LSGM powder was deposited by EPD on an LDC green tape-cast membrane added with carbon powder, both as pore former and substrate conductivity booster. A subsequent co-firing step at 1490 °C produced dense electrolyte films on porous LDC skeletons. Then, a La0.8Sr0.2Fe0.8Co0.2O3−δ (LSFC) cathode was applied by slurry-coating and calcined at 1100 °C. Finally, the porous LDC layer was impregnated with molten Ni nitrate to obtain, after calcination at 900 °C, a composite NiO–LDC anode. Maximum power densities of 780, 450, 275, 175, and 100 mW/cm2 at 700, 650, 600, 550, and 500 °C, respectively, were obtained using H2 as fuel and air as oxidant, demonstrating the success of the processing strategy. As a comparison, electrolyte-supported SOFCs made of the same materials were tested, showing a maximum power density of 150 mW/cm2 at 700 °C, more than 5 times smaller than the anode-supported counterpart.  相似文献

A comparative study is carried out on the effect of cosintering temperature of anode–electrolyte bilayer on the fabrication and cell performance of anode-supported solid oxide fuel cells from commercially available tape casting materials. It was found that the sintering conditions have profound effects on the anode characteristic and cell performance. For low cosintering temperature as low as 1,250 °C, the electrolyte is unable to sinter fully and forms a porous structure which leads to a reduced open-circuit potential and poor cell performance especially under low current output. For further increasing cosintering temperature to 1,350 °C, the cell performance was lower under low current operation. However, the cell performance turns out to be better than that of high-temperature cosintering under high current output. Although at temperature as high as 1,500 °C the cell performs better than that of low temperature cosintering, the trend turn out to be reverse for high current operating due to less anode surface area resulting from overagglomeration of anode layer. An optimal cosintering temperature of 1,350–1,450 °C is recommended for commercially available anode–electrolyte bilayer of anode-supported solid oxide fuel cells.  相似文献

An important objective in the development of solid oxide fuel cell (SOFC) is to produce thin stabilized zirconia electrolytes that are supported upon the nickel–zirconia composite anode. Although this will reduce some of the problems associated with SOFCs by permitting lower temperature operation, this design may encounter problems during start- up. The first step in a start-up involves the reduction of nickel oxide in the anode to metallic nickel and increase of three-phase boundary will be beneficial for further reaction. In this study, two pretreatment methods are investigated for their effects on the performances of SOFC. Performances of the SOFCs are influenced by the pretreatment conditions, which included exposure of the cells to dilute H2/O2 either under open-circuit or closed-circuit conditions before their performance studies. By carrying out the methods, the pretreatment using the closed circuit is found to attain much higher performances effectively and efficiently. Accompanying with SEM and element analysis, increase of three-phase boundary is considered to give rise to changes in the anode microstructure, leading to activation of the anode. Mechanisms of NiO in anode reducing to Ni and porous structure via different pretreatments and their effects on the anode microstructure are proposed.  相似文献
